The BMW 3 SERIES COMPACT (2001-05) 318TI 3DR COMPACT 2.0 SE AUTO REV 03 is a distinctive hatchback that occupies a unique spot in the UK's used car market. Designed primarily for urban drivers and small families, this model is known for its stylish, compact design combined with a relatively spacious interior. Its 3-door layout offers a sporty yet practical choice for those seeking a nimble car for both daily commuting and weekend adventures. Typically used by individuals or small households, the BMW 318TI stands out for its engaging drive, reliable performance, and distinctive European styling.
What makes this model particularly notable is its balance of sporty handling and ease of use, making it an appealing choice compared to other compact hatchbacks in its class. Its automatic transmission offers a smooth driving experience, while the 2.0-litre engine delivers enough power for city driving and motorway cruising. colour popularity

The data indicates that among the 'BMW 3 SERIES COMPACT (2001-05) 318TI 3DR COMPACT 2.0 SE AUTO REV 03' vehicles, blue is the most common paint colour, accounting for 43.8% of the fleet. Silver is also prevalent, comprising 31.3%, while grey is present in 18.8% of vehicles. Black is quite rare, representing only 6.3%. This suggests that the majority of these vehicles favor cooler tones, particularly shades of blue and silver, with black being less popular among owners of this specific model and range.

engine choices

The data indicates that all BMW 3 Series Compact (2001-05) 318TI 3DR models with the specified details are equipped with a 2.0-litre engine, and their primary fuel type is petrol. Notably, 100% of the sampled vehicles have an engine capacity of 1995cc, which suggests a consistent engine size across the model period.
